i've read somewhere that Ford switched over to 75w 140 in '01 but i'm not sure. RTV or gasket maker is a silicone sealer that's in a little tube, personally i think makes a better seal than just a gasket
 
You use RTV to spread on the surface of the differential cover and the edge of the differential to make a good seal.

When you change the fluid, scrape all the funk off the cover/diff and then spray down the diff cover with brake parts cleaner/carb cleaner to clean it, wipe it down. Take a old t-shirt or another lint free rag and wipe down the inside of the differential. Before you apply the RTV, make sure that the mating surfaces are clean. Spread it over the bolt holes, put the cover back on, tighten bolts, done.

Not difficult at all. Just messy!! Get lots of paper towels and newspaper.
